Transaction 9619884c906355728b991bb29b2385de1de528b9a93d9388d623a5b8a0ba3b61
1 Input
1 Output
-
9619884c906355728b991bb29b2385de1de528b9a93d9388d623a5b8a0ba3b61:0
- value
- 35758566
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 81c437a52413fb8b567bb5ef434cdcae331d9bcb OP_EQUAL
- address
- 3DXA9iD6wSNJZryj8BswrKMWLm5Q7F6jsJ